(1)MyBatis-Plus是MyBatis的增强,在MyBatis的基础上,只做增强而不做改变,是为了简化开发、提高效率而生。 (2)MyBatis-Plus所需要的依赖: AI检测代码解析 <?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ema...
mybatis-plus.configuration.log-impl=org.apache.ibatis.logging.stdout.StdOutImp 1. 2. 3. 4. 5. 6. 7. 8. 操作前的准备 使用mybatisPlus的mapper接口 使用mybatisPlus以后,则无需写xml文件里的sql语句了(指基本的增删改),默认就拥有了基本的api,例如deleteByid,updateById等 想要自定义其他sql写法和连表...
MyBatis Plus 3.5.1 Spring Boot 2.6.4 Postgresql 42.3.3 与Spring Boot 结合使用 MyBatis 以下说明Spring Boot下完全以注解方式进行的配置, 覆盖大部分功能场景 项目依赖 需要以下的依赖, 版本由Spring Boot指定, 或者参考上面的版本号 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>sp...
在将MyBatis-Plus与PostgreSQL集成时,你需要遵循以下步骤来确保集成成功并顺利进行数据操作。以下是详细的步骤和示例代码: 1. 添加MyBatisPlus和PostgreSQL的依赖 在你的pom.xml文件中添加MyBatis-Plus和PostgreSQL的依赖。这将确保你的项目能够使用MyBatis-Plus提供的功能,并且能够连接到PostgreSQL数据库。 xml <depend...
默认情况下,MyBatis-Plus 可能不直接支持 PostgreSQL 的数组类型。但是,你可以通过自定义类型处理器来实现对数组的支持。 自定义类型处理器:你需要创建一个实现了 org.apache.ibatis.type.TypeHandler 接口的类,并重写其中的方法来处理数组类型和 Java 类型之间的转换。 XML 映射文件:在 MyBatis 的 XML 映射文件中...
普及一下,上面的IPage是mybatis plus自带的分页插件,可以参考https://baomidou.com/guide/crud-interface.html#page,但是需要提前配置,配置方式如下: 4. mybatis plus配置分页插件 (1) 在Springboot中添加配置类 @Configuration@MapperScan("com.jack.db.mapper")publicclassMybatisPlusConfig{@BeanpublicMybatisPlus...
在将MyBatis-Plus与PostgreSQL数据库整合时,开发者们可能会遇到关于timestamp类型数据的转换问题。为了更高效地进行代码编写和调试,推荐使用百度智能云文心快码(Comate),它是一款强大的代码生成工具,能够显著提升开发效率。详情请参考:百度智能云文心快码。 由于MyBatis-Plus和PostgreSQL在数据表示和存储方式上的差异,如果不...
关于MyBatis-Plus是否支持PostgreSQL的升级,答案是肯定的。MyBatis-Plus完全兼容MyBatis的所有功能,而MyBatis本身是支持PostgreSQL数据库的。因此,使用MyBatis-Plus进行PostgreSQL的升级是没有问题的。 在使用MyBatis-Plus进行PostgreSQL的升级时,可以按照以下步骤进行操作: 确保你的项目中已经引入了MyBatis-Plus的依赖。可以...
postgresql-spring-boot-mybatis-plus 项目介绍 postgresql 数据库使用mybatis-plus ,使用druid 连接chi 软件架构 软件架构说明 使用说明 postgresql-spring-boot-mybatis-plus postgresql 数据库使用mybatis-plus 添加依赖 com.baomidou mybatisplus-spring-boot-starter 1.0.5 com.baomidou mybatis-plus 2.3 org....
引入了mybatis-plus-boot-starter和mybatis-plus的包后,不要再引入mybatis-spring-boot-starter相关的包,以免引起jar包冲突 配置数据库连接信息 在配置文件中配置数据库连接的信息,代码生成器中直接读取配置文件的信息,不需要重复配置 具体实现 ```java